Enhancing Model Order Reduction for Nonlinear Analog Circuit Simulation

Traditionally, model order reduction methods have been used to reduce the computational complexity of mathematical models of dynamic systems, while preserving their functional characteristics. This technique can also be used to fasten analog circuit simulations without sacrificing their highly nonlinear behavior. In this paper, we present an iterative approach for reducing the computational complexity of nonlinear analog circuits using piecewise linear approximations, k-means clustering, and Krylov space projection techniques. We model primary circuit inputs, design initial conditions, and circuit parameters as fuzzy variables with different distributions in qualitative simulations. We then iteratively fine-tune the reduced models until a model is achieved that meets a predefined performance and accuracy conformance criteria. We demonstrate the effectiveness of our method using several key nonlinear circuits: 1) a transmission line; 2) a ring oscillator; 3) a voltage controlled oscillator; 4) a phase-locked loop; and 5) an analog comparator circuit. Our experiments show that the reduced model simulations are fast and accurate compared with the existing techniques.

[1]  Chenjie Gu,et al.  QLMOR: A Projection-Based Nonlinear Model Order Reduction Approach Using Quadratic-Linear Representation of Nonlinear Systems , 2011, IEEE Transactions on Computer-Aided Design of Integrated Circuits and Systems.

[2]  W. Rugh Nonlinear System Theory: The Volterra / Wiener Approach , 1981 .

[3]  Sofiène Tahar,et al.  Towards improving simulation of analog circuits using model order reduction , 2012, 2012 Design, Automation & Test in Europe Conference & Exhibition (DATE).

[4]  Charlie Chung-Ping Chen,et al.  Hierarchical model order reduction for signal-integrity interconnect synthesis , 2001, GLSVLSI '01.

[5]  R. Freund Krylov-subspace methods for reduced-order modeling in circuit simulation , 2000 .

[6]  Gianluca Bontempi Simulating continuous dynamical systems under conditions of uncertainty: the probability and the possibility approaches , 2004 .

[7]  Athanasios C. Antoulas,et al.  Approximation of Large-Scale Dynamical Systems (Advances in Design and Control) (Advances in Design and Control) , 2005 .

[8]  Janne Roos,et al.  Hierarchical Model-Order Reduction Flow , 2010 .

[9]  Jacob K. White,et al.  A trajectory piecewise-linear approach to model order reduction and fast simulation of nonlinear circuits and micromachined devices , 2001, IEEE/ACM International Conference on Computer Aided Design. ICCAD 2001. IEEE/ACM Digest of Technical Papers (Cat. No.01CH37281).

[10]  Sheldon X.-D. Tan,et al.  Advanced Model Order Reduction Techniques in VLSI Design , 2007 .

[11]  Sofiène Tahar,et al.  Enablingy the DC solutions characterization using a fuzzy approach , 2014, 2014 IEEE 12th International New Circuits and Systems Conference (NEWCAS).

[12]  Yan Li,et al.  Compact Modeling of Nonlinear Analog Circuits Using System Identification via Semidefinite Programming and Incremental Stability Certification , 2009, IEEE Transactions on Computer-Aided Design of Integrated Circuits and Systems.

[13]  Georges G. E. Gielen,et al.  Characterization of Analog Circuits Using Transfer Function Trajectories , 2012, IEEE Transactions on Circuits and Systems I: Regular Papers.

[14]  R. W. Kelsall,et al.  The Monte Carlo method for semiconductor device simulation , 1995 .

[15]  Michael Hinze,et al.  POD Model Order Reduction of Drift-Diffusion Equations in Electrical Networks , 2011 .

[16]  Sofiène Tahar,et al.  A qualitative simulation approach for verifying PLL locking property , 2014, GLSVLSI '14.

[17]  Likun Xia,et al.  Automated Model Generation of Analog Circuits through Modified Trajectory Piecewise Linear Approach with Cheby Shev Newton Interpolating Polynomials , 2013, 2013 4th International Conference on Intelligent Systems, Modelling and Simulation.

[18]  Jaijeet Roychowdhury,et al.  Model reduction via projection onto nonlinear manifolds, with applications to analog circuits and biochemical systems , 2008, ICCAD 2008.

[19]  Ning Dong,et al.  General-Purpose Nonlinear Model-Order Reduction Using Piecewise-Polynomial Representations , 2008, IEEE Transactions on Computer-Aided Design of Integrated Circuits and Systems.

[20]  L. Sirovich Turbulence and the dynamics of coherent structures. I. Coherent structures , 1987 .

[21]  Qing Wang,et al.  Fast nonlinear model order reduction via associated transforms of high-order Volterra transfer functions , 2012, DAC Design Automation Conference 2012.

[22]  P. R. Bevington,et al.  Data Reduction and Error Analysis for the Physical Sciences , 1969 .

[23]  Sofiène Tahar,et al.  Generation of reduced analog circuit models using transient simulation traces , 2014, GLSVLSI '14.

[24]  Athanasios C. Antoulas,et al.  Approximation of Large-Scale Dynamical Systems , 2005, Advances in Design and Control.

[25]  R. Jacob Baker,et al.  CMOS Circuit Design, Layout, and Simulation , 1997 .

[26]  Joel R. Phillips Automated extraction of nonlinear circuit macromodels , 2000, Proceedings of the IEEE 2000 Custom Integrated Circuits Conference (Cat. No.00CH37044).

[27]  Lihong Feng,et al.  Review of model order reduction methods for numerical simulation of nonlinear circuits , 2005, Appl. Math. Comput..

[28]  Yong Chen Model order reduction for nonlinear systems , 1999 .

[29]  M. Nabi,et al.  Adaptive sampling of nonlinear system trajectory for Model Order Reduction , 2012, 2012 Proceedings of International Conference on Modelling, Identification and Control.

[30]  Shahkar Ahmad Nahvi,et al.  Nonlinearity-aware sub-model combination in trajectory based methods for nonlinear Mor , 2013, Math. Comput. Simul..

[31]  L. Sirovich TURBULENCE AND THE DYNAMICS OF COHERENT STRUCTURES PART I : COHERENT STRUCTURES , 2016 .